Recycle
Possibly the most significant thing we can do is Recycle. There are many programs out there that offer recycling services. You can choose, in some cases, to recycle at home and have the recycling service pick up your recyclable products every week, it's kind of the same as the garbage service. Or you can find Recycling centers. It is as easy as going to earth911.com. Just remember to do a little research before disposing of certain items like electronics or batteries. These items sometimes have certain precautions. Also rinse out any glass, or aluminum cans you have before recycling them.
Switch to Energy efficient Lighting
The switch is simple and easy and not only saves the environment, but also your wallet. You can be saving 25% in lighting bills by just switching to these fluorescent light bulbs. With the Green Movement growing the industry has come out with some "normal" looking fluorescent light bulbs. Plus, did you know that these bulbs are easier on the eyes, and yet they do not loose the brightness quality ? They also have a longer lifetime and produce 75% less heat than a standard bulb. (Keep in mind these bulbs sometimes can cost more than a standard bulb, however they save you money in the long run.)
Use Energy-Star Appliances
There is a rating system Energy Star uses to rate products that make them environmentally friend. These products range from ovens to air conditioners to heating appliances. Of them all you really want to use Energy Star rated Heating appliances and solutions as Heating takes up on average a total of 29% of Energy usage in homes. These solutions include changing your air filter, Tuning up your HVAC equipment yearly, installing a programmable thermostat, and sealing your heating and cooling ducts and any other areas in the home where heat can escape including your window and door seals. Energy star windows and proper installation can save anywhere from $20 to $95 per Year!
Conserve Water
Speaking of saving money, You can easily save money by conserving water. There are many ways to conserve water.
While brushing your teeth, shut off the water. If you need water, fill a 8 oz glass of water and use that water to rinse your mouth and tooth brush. Also there are some shower filters that conserve water. It's called gpm or gallons per minute. Try using a 2 gpm shower head. Plant a Garden/ (nurture) Houseplants
Yes Gardening and household plants. Gardening is a great way to save money as well. Planting and attending a garden also releases tension and stress as well burning calories, plus it adds color to your life and diet. Eating from a home (organic) garden is a fantastic way to be eco-friendly. Plus there are garden kits yo can buy if you live in an apartment and find yourself without a backyard. As far as houseplants, they are great for reducing the air pollution in your home. The EPA have studies showing that the air quality in homes is significantly more polluted than that of the outdoors! Use Recycled Paper Products
Using recycled paper products saves trees plain and simple. Using recycled paper eliminates the need to cut down more trees, which in essences saves the rain forests. Which in turns save the rain forests. Which in turns saves millions of living creatures and species. Buy using recycled, or eco paper you are also saving energy- 60-70% energy savings over virgin pulp.
